In Microsoft Word, the fax symbol in the Wingdings font is represented by the character that corresponds to the letter "P." To insert it, change the font to Wingdings and type the letter "P," which will display as a fax machine icon. You can also access it through the "Insert" menu by selecting "Symbol" and then choosing Wingdings from the font options.

It's short for facsimile - The word facsimile means 'likeness' or 'copy' - which is what a fax machine gives the recipient - a copy of the original document.
Fax template, or fax cover template, or fax cover sheet template is used for transfer of information via facsimile Fax template usually includes a header with the word "fax" or "fax transmittal", the date, the sender, the recipient, the subject of a fax, the number of pages, and the message.
